We are seeking a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) or Licensed Vocational Nurse (LVN) to serve as a Clinical Preceptor. In this role, you will provide guidance, mentorship, and clinical instruction to our medical assistant and/or new staff in a clinical setting.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ide hands-on training and support to learners in accordance with clinical standards and organizational policies.
  • Demonstrate and teach clinical procedures, patient care techniques, and documentation requirements.
  • Evaluate learner performance and provide constructive feedback.
  • Serve as a role model for professional practice and uphold regulatory and safety standards

About CenterWell Senior Primary Care: CenterWell Senior Primary Care provides proactive, preventive care to seniors, including wellness visits, physical exams, chronic condition management, screenings, minor injury treatment and more. Our unique care model focuses on personalized experiences, taking time to listen, learn and address the factors that impact patient well-being. Our integrated care teams, which include physicians, nurses, behavioral health specialists and more, spend up to 50 percent more time with patients, providing compassionate, personalized care that brings better health outcomes. We go beyond physical health by also addressing other factors that can impact a patient’s well-being.
